  • Patent number: 8122685
    Abstract: A wrapper dispensing mechanism for round balers includes a feed roller shiftable generally toward and away from a baling element of a bale forming mechanism so as to be selectively brought into and out of engagement with the baling element. The feed roller is driven by the baling element when the feed roller is in engagement with the baling element, with the feed roller and the baling element cooperatively defining a temporary nip therebetween during engagement. The feed roller is disposed to at least partially vertically support the roll of supply material thereon. A method of dispensing wrapping material from a supply roll includes supporting the supply roll at least partially on a feed roller, shifting the feed roller into engagement with the baling element to create a temporary nip therebetween and drive the feed roller, and driving the baling element while the feed roller is in engagement therewith.

  • Patent number: 7913482
    Abstract: A bale shape monitor for assisting an operator of a round baler. The bale shape monitor has an indicator with variable sensitivity. The indicator is less sensitive for small bales and more sensitive for larger bales so that the indicator de-emphasizes bale shape problems at the beginning of bale formation and emphasizes bale shape problems when the bale is almost fully formed. The indicator also changes colors according to the degree the bale is misshapen and provides textual driving instructions.

  • Patent number: 7337713
    Abstract: A bale wrapping control system that enables several custom bale wrapping patterns which more effectively wrap and maintain the integrity of bales formed in a round baler. The bale wrapping control system controls operation of a dispensing arm which dispenses twine or other bale wrapping material. The dispensing arm is moveable between a start position where an end of the dispensing arm is closest to the bale, a left edge position where the end of the dispensing arm is near a left edge of the bale, a right edge position where the end of the dispensing arm is near a right edge of the bale, and a cutoff or home position where the end of the dispensing arm passes a cutting mechanism. The bale wrapping control system includes a baler controller for controlling movement of the dispensing arm and a user interface for receiving operating instructions from an operator of the baler and for controlling certain functions of the baler controller in response to the operating instructions.
